Somebody posted about kid playing chess the other day. I have a friend whose kid is playing chess. The boy started high school this year (2011). His rating is ~2000. My friend estimated that his son can probably win top 3 in state tournament, but it will be very difficult to win anything at the national level tournament. As many chess parents here know, playing chess is very time consuming and also relies on talent, especially after the 2000 mark. He is not sure whether they should still put efforts on chess or should give it up, as it is too challenging at the national tourment. My kid, who is still young, is also playing chess, pretty good but clearly not a genius. We all have same questions. How will playing chess help a kid to get into a top universities? Will state champion or top 3 medal in a state tournament be helpful at all, or the kid has to get into top 3 at a national tournament? Will one's rating be important? ~2000 rating probably can rank at 30-50 of the same age players (16-18).Will this rating be considered as an achievement? We will appreciate your opinion on this.
